Artist Registry


The White Columns Curated Artist Registry is an online platform for emerging and under-recognized artists to share images and information about their respective practices. The Registry seeks to create a context for artists who have yet to benefit from wider critical, curatorial or commercial support. To be eligible, artists cannot be affiliated with a commercial gallery in New York City.

Leor Miller is a photographer, musician, and writer from Evanston, IL currently based in Brooklyn. She received a BA in Photography from Bard College in 2019 and an MFA in Photography from the Yale School of Art in 2025. 

Leor’s photographs approach the world as a space of mystery. Working primarily with pinhole and panoramic cameras, she questions the role photography has historically played in depicting the earth and its human subjects as stable, knowable entities. She is particularly interested in instances where photography fails to produce concrete knowledge as a result of the ever-shifting boundaries between the self and the world.

She is a transgender woman.
